Alpha Architect U.S. Quantitative Value ETF (NASDAQ:QVAL) Short Interest Update

Alpha Architect U.S. Quantitative Value ETF (NASDAQ:QVALGet Free Report) was the target of a significant decline in short interest during the month of July. As of July 15th, there was short interest totaling 47,415 shares, a decline of 45.2% from the June 30th total of 86,500 shares. Approximately 0.5% of the company’s shares are short sold.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 37,555 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 1.3 days.

About Alpha Architect U.S. Quantitative Value ETF

(Get Free Report)

The Alpha Architect US Quantitative Value ETF (QVAL)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in total market equity. The fund is an active, equal-weighted portfolio of US value stocks, screened for forensic accounting and earnings quality. QVAL was launched on Oct 22, 2014 and is issued by Alpha Architect.
